Mikhail Corporation has the following sales forecasts for the first three months of the current year:

Month Sales January $36,000

February 24,000

March 40,000

Sixty-five percent of sales are collected in the month of the sale and the remainder are collected in the following month. Mikhail will borrow from its bank to maintain its minimum cash balance.

Accounts receivable balance (January 1) $16,000

Cash balance (January 1) 12,000

Minimum cash balance needed 20,000

What is the cash balance at the end of January, assuming that cash is received only from customers and that $48,000 is paid out during January?

Group of answer choices

$21,000

$23,400

$19,400

$20,000
